    Battery storage - hibernation mode

    You have some good advice, but I think it's a bit extreme compared to what I do. First: I don't trust any battery to self-discharge (at least to the proper capacity). I always store my batteries ~50% after flying (no matter how long in between use), and charge them to 100% right before flying...

    New Mavic 2 batteries, keep uncharged, or charge immediately?

    All Lithium battery types are affected by how "deeply" they are cycled and the temperatures they are exposed to (especially during charging). You don't say what climate you live in or how you cycle your batteries (I don't deep cycle and store them @50%), but I suspect you were more smart than lucky.
